Bridge is Tier II. Looks like you are only at Tier I Infrastructure there.

Other Tier I possibilities: Copper Mine (requires Copper), Expert Stonecutter (requires Rough), Iron Mine (requires Iron), Lead Mine (requires Lead), Sawmill (requires Forest), Tin Mine (requires Tin).

Quarry requires Rough, so assuming this is Rough ... Expert Stonecutter might be missing?
